What is CompX International's Growth Strategy?
CompX International Inc. reported a strong Q2 2025 with net sales up 12.3% to $40.3 million, a notable rebound from a full-year 2024 sales dip. This performance underscores the company's adaptability in dynamic markets.
The company, a key player in security products and recreational marine components since 1983, aims for leadership through innovation and market expansion. Its strategic focus is on delivering long-term shareholder value.

How Is CompX Expanding Its Reach?
CompX International is actively pursuing a growth strategy centered on specialized markets and strategic positioning. The company has seen increased sales in both its Security Products and Marine Components segments, with a particular focus on government security and towboat sectors.
The Security Products segment experienced a significant 9% year-over-year increase in net sales in Q2 2025. This growth highlights the company's success in this specialized area.
The Marine Components segment saw a substantial 26% year-over-year increase in net sales, largely driven by demand from government customers. This indicates a strong strategic focus on this client base.
The company's increasing reliance on government contracts is a strategic positive, offering revenue stability and consistent growth opportunities. This focus is a key driver for CompX business development.
Historically, the company has shown a willingness to pursue strategic acquisitions to broaden its market presence, such as the 2019 acquisition of Waterloo Furniture Components Co. This demonstrates a proactive approach to market expansion.

What Is CompX’s Growth Forecast?
The company's financial performance in the first half of 2025 indicates a strong upward trend, with net sales and operating income showing significant year-over-year increases. This robust performance suggests a successful implementation of its CompX growth strategy.
Net sales reached $40.3 million, a 12.3% increase from Q2 2024. Operating income grew by 23.5% to $6.3 million, demonstrating improved operational efficiency.
Net sales for the first half of 2025 were $80.6 million, up 9.1% from the prior year. Operating income surged 38.6% to $12.2 million, reflecting strong business development.
Net income for Q2 2025 was $5.5 million, a 12.2% increase. The gross margin expanded to 32.0% in Q2 2025, up from 30.9% in Q2 2024, indicating effective cost management.
The company declared a special cash dividend of $1.00 per share, payable in August 2025, alongside its regular quarterly dividend, underscoring a commitment to stockholder distributions.
While the full-year 2024 results showed a dip in net sales to $145.9 million from $161.3 million in 2023, and net income decreased to $16.6 million from $22.6 million, the first half of 2025 performance presents a significant turnaround. What Risks Could Slow CompX’s Growth?
CompX International's growth strategy is subject to several potential risks and obstacles that require careful management. Fluctuations in raw material costs, intense competition from lower-cost manufacturing regions, and broader market uncertainties are ongoing concerns. The company also faces potential legal challenges and the need to adapt to evolving regulatory landscapes.
Despite recent improvements in gross margins, the cost of raw materials remains a significant and persistent challenge for CompX. Managing these fluctuations is crucial for maintaining profitability and supporting its CompX growth strategy.
CompX operates in markets characterized by intense competition, particularly from manufacturers with lower cost structures. This necessitates a strong focus on differentiation and efficiency to maintain its competitive advantage.
Broader market conditions and rising operational costs present ongoing uncertainties that could impact CompX's future performance. Adapting to these dynamic factors is key to its CompX business development.
Potential ongoing litigation, such as that concerning the use of specific chemicals in production, introduces legal uncertainties. Furthermore, new environmental, health, and safety standards could necessitate operational adjustments and investments.
Vulnerabilities within the supply chain and the potential for technological disruption are recognized risks. CompX must remain agile to mitigate these issues and ensure continuity in its CompX innovation strategy.
To counter these risks, CompX is strategically diversifying its revenue streams. An increasing focus on government contracts for security products and marine components aims to establish a more stable revenue base, supporting its CompX future prospects.
